Oct 27, 2022 · Section 501 (c) (3) of the U.S. Internal Revenue Code allows qualifying nonprofit or not-for-profit organizations to claim federal tax-exempt status. 501 (c) (3) organizations are exempt from federal income tax. Donations made to 501 (c) (3)s are tax-deductible. Other benefits of 501 (c) (3) status include possible exemption from state income ... Dec 1, 2022 · State law governs nonprofit status, which is determined by an organization’s articles of incorporation or trust documents. Federal law governs tax-exempt status. The Internal Revenue Code specifically refers to exemption from federal income tax. Section 501 (c) (3) is the portion of the US Internal Revenue Code that allows for federal tax exemption of nonprofit organizations, specifically those that are considered public charities, private foundations or private operating foundations. It is regulated and administered by the US Department of Treasury through the Internal ... The IRS sends back Form 990 series returns filed on paper – and rejects electronically filed returns – when they are ...To start a nonprofit in Pennsylvania and get 501c3 status, follow these steps: Step 1: Name Your Pennsylvania Nonprofit. Step 2: Choose Your Registered Agent. Step 3: Select Your Board Members & Officers. Step 4: Adopt Bylaws & Conflict of Interest Policy. Step 5: File the Articles of Incorporation. Step 6: Get an EIN.
